DELHI STATE CONSUMER DISPUTES REDRESSAL COMMISSION
J.D. Kapoor, President, Rumnita Mittal, Member
Alliance Air Limited – Appellant
Versus
Daljit Singh Nirman – Respondent


ORAL

J.D. Kapoor, President

1. On account of late running of the flight, the District Forum has vide impugned order dated 18.08.1999 held the appellant guilty for deficiency in service and directed it to pay Rs.5,000/- as compensation and Rs.1,000/- as cost.

2. Feeling aggrieved the appellant has preferred this appeal.

3. There is no dispute that the respondent booked himself by Flight No. ICCD 421 scheduled to leave Delhi on 26.09.1996 at 10.10 hours for Jammu and when he reached the airport for check in, he was informed that flight shall leave at 12.00 hours, whereas it actual took off at 14.00 hours and therefore he suffered physical discomfort, mental agony by waiting for about six hours and as a result he could not reach Jammu in time nor could he attend the meeting at Jammu, for which he was going there.

4.
